FileTypeDB

.DSL File Extension

A .DSL file is a Lingvo Dictionary File, created by ABBYY.

Open with GoldenDict. Available for Windows.

What is a .DSL file?

The .DSL file extension refers to a Lingvo Dictionary File. This type of file is primarily used by the Lingvo Dictionary software, which is a tool designed to help users translate words between different languages and to provide definitions for various terms. Inside a .DSL file, you will find dictionary entries. Each entry consists of two main parts: the headword of the card, which is the word being defined or translated, and the body of the card, which contains the definition or translation of the word.

To open a .DSL file, you can use several programs: 1. **GoldenDict** - This is a versatile dictionary program that can run on various operating systems, including Windows and Linux. 2. **Android devices** - There are apps like ABBYY Lingvo Dictionaries available for Android that can open .DSL files. 3. **ABBYY Lingvo Dictionaries for Android** - This specific app is designed to work with Lingvo dictionary files on Android devices.

### More Information on Creating and Using .DSL Files: If you want to create your own .DSL file, you can start by creating a plain text document with a .TXT extension. In this document, you need to format your dictionary entries correctly according to the DSL format. Once your entries are prepared, you rename the file's extension from ".txt" to ".dsl".

After creating a .DSL file, you can use the DSL Compiler provided by the Lingvo Dictionary application to convert your .DSL file into an .LSD file, which is another type of dictionary file used by Lingvo. The DSL Compiler processes the entries in the .DSL file and compiles them into the more compact .LSD format.

When setting up your .DSL file, you can use specific commands in the header to define the dictionary's name and the languages involved: - `#NAME "Dictionary_Name"` specifies the name of your dictionary. - `#INDEX_LANGUAGE "Source_Language"` and `#CONTENTS_LANGUAGE "Target_Language"` define the languages used for the dictionary entries. - `#INCLUDE "C:\\Dictionaries\\Dictionary_file.dsl"` can be used if you want to include entries from another .DSL file. Make sure to use double backslashes (`\\`) in the file path.

Additionally, when compiling the .DSL file, you have the option to create a .DDE error log file to track any compilation errors. This log file will have the same name as your .DSL file but with

Verification

Our goal is to help people find the most up-to-date information about file extensions for Windows, Mac, Linux, Android and iOS. We researched over 10,000 file extensions and their respective programs that open those files. If you want to suggest edits or updates about .DSL file formats, example files, or programs that are compatible. Please contact us.

More extensions